JAMMU, Nov 27: 1000’s of devotees flocked to Jhiri village on the outskirts of Jammu the place an annual 10-day truthful commenced on Monday.
Jammu Divisional Commissioner Ramesh Kumar inaugurated the mela.
Eight to 10 lakh devotees, primarily from Jammu area, Punjab, Himachal Pradesh and Haryana, go to the truthful yearly to commemorate the sacrifice of Baba Jitto, a farmer who gave up his life in protest towards the oppressive calls for of a zamindar about 500 years in the past.
His daughter Bua Kouri, based on the legend, took her life by leaping on her father’s funeral pyre.
Through the Jhiri Mela, devotees pay obeisance at a temple devoted to Baba Jitto and his daughter on the Jammu-Akhnoor nationwide freeway.
Devotees take customary dips within the Baba-da-Talab, a pure pond 4 km from the temple, earlier than providing prayers.
Temple head priest Bubnesh Mehta stated this is without doubt one of the largest gala’s in north India with round one lakh folks visiting the place day by day.
